The Scarlets take on the Lions in Johannesburg this afternoon (2pm) in arguably the biggest game of their season as Dwayne Peel's side chase a place in the United Rugby Championship play-offs.
Results did not go the Scarlets' way yesterday and this is must-win territory for the west Walians who are also chasing a place in next season's Champions Cup. The Scarlets are in 10th place on the URC table, just three points off Cardiff who occupy the final play-off place.
Peel's side will be full of confidence after overcoming Leinster a fortnight back and have selected a strong team.
Scotland prop Alec Hepburn, South African hooker Marnus van der Merwe and Wales tighthead Henry Thomas pack down in the front-row with Alex Craig and Sam Lousi in the second-row.
Josh Macleod captains the side and is joined in the backrow by Taine Plumtree and Vaea Fifita. Gareth Davies and Sam Costelow are the half-backs with Johnny Williams and Joe Roberts in midfield.
Blair Murray, Tom Rogers and Ellis Mee make up an exciting back three, while Wales loosehead Kemsley Mathias returns from injury to take his place on the replacements' bench.
Kick-off is at 2pm with the game live on S4C and Premier Sports.

Lions: Quan Horn; Richard Kriel, Henco van Wyk, Bronson Mills, Edwill van der Merwe, Kade Wolhuter; Nico Steyn, Morgan Naude; Jaco Visagie (capt), Asenathi Ntlabakanye, Ruan Venter, Ruan Delport, JC Pretorius, Renzo du Plessis, Jarod Cairns. Replacements: PJ Botha, SJ Kotze, RF Schoeman, Darrien Landsberg, Sibabalo Qoma, Layton Horn, Lubabalo Dobela, Rynhardt Jonker.
Scarlets: Blair Murray; Tom Rogers, Joe Roberts, Johnny Williams, Ellis Mee; Sam Costelow, Gareth Davies; Alec Hepburn, Marnus van der Merwe, Henry Thomas, Alex Craig, Sam Lousi, Vaea Fifita, Josh Macleod (capt), Taine Plumtree. Replacements: Ryan Elias, Kemsley Mathias, Sam Wainwright, Dan Davis, Jarrod Taylor, Archie Hughes, Ioan Lloyd, Macs Page.
Referee: Andrew Brace (IRFU)
Assistant referees: Griffin Colby (SARU), Stephan Geldenhuys (SARU)
TMO: Eoghan Cross (IRFU)
